Multi-unit construction means coordinating with developers, general contractors, and local inspectors to ensure that every phase of electrical installation meets code, stays on schedule, and delivers a system capable of handling peak loads across multiple units. Metering setups must be configured to allow individual billing while maintaining centralized distribution for common areas. Panels are sized to handle unit-specific loads—HVAC, appliances, lighting—without overloading shared circuits. Common-area lighting, entry systems, and outdoor fixtures are planned for both safety and energy efficiency, reducing operating costs for property managers.
Coordinating Electrical Work With Developers and Inspectors
Multi-unit residential construction in Spirit Lake requires close coordination between electrical contractors, developers, and building inspectors. Experience with this process means understanding local permitting timelines, anticipating inspection requirements, and delivering work that passes review without delays. Each unit's electrical system must be isolated properly to prevent cross-circuit issues, while shared infrastructure—such as exterior lighting or security systems—needs centralized control and easy maintenance access.
Metering configurations vary depending on utility provider requirements and property layout, but the goal is always clear: accurate billing for tenants and straightforward maintenance for property owners. Panel layouts are designed with future access in mind, allowing electricians to service individual units without disrupting neighbors. Scalability is built into every system, so additional units or future upgrades can be integrated without major rework. What Makes Multi-Unit Electrical Systems Different
Multi-unit residential construction demands electrical systems that balance individual unit needs with shared infrastructure, all while meeting strict code requirements and supporting property management goals. Here's what goes into a well-designed multi-unit electrical system:
- Metering setups configured for individual billing and utility compliance across duplexes, apartments, and residential developments
- Unit-specific panels sized for typical residential loads, with room for future appliance additions
- Common-area lighting and outdoor fixtures designed for safety, energy efficiency, and ease of maintenance in Spirit Lake's climate
- Coordination with developers and inspectors to ensure timely permits, inspections, and final approval
- Scalable designs that allow for phased construction or future expansion without major electrical rework
